3.1.7 Other Options
The following actions may be performed on the HSM2HOST:
Table 3-1: HSM2HOST Options
Section
[902][106] Delete the HSM2HOST from the alarm system.
[903][106] Confirm that the HSM2HOST is enrolled.
[000][806] Add a label to appear on LCD keypads.
[900][461] View HSM2HOST model information.
3.2 Wireless Device Setup and Programming
This section describes how to enroll and program wireless devices such as contacts, motion sensors and sirens on the alarm panel.
3.2.1 [804][000] Enroll Wireless Devices
1.
Once the HSM2HOST is installed and enrolled on the alarm panel, wireless devices can be enrolled using the following method: Enter
Installer Programming section [804][000]:
2.
When prompted, either activate the device (see device installation sheet) to enroll immediately or enter a device ID number. Do the latter to pre-
enroll devices then enroll them later at the customer site.
The alarm panel determines the type of device being enrolled and presents the appropriate programming options.
Table 3-2: Wireless Device Options
Device Type
Programming Options
Zone
(01) Zone type
(02) Partition assignment
(03) Zone label
Wireless key
(01) Partition assignment
(02) User label
Siren
(01) Partition assignment
(02) Siren label
Repeater
(01) Repeater label
3.
Use the scroll keys or type in the corresponding number to select an option.
4.
Scroll through the available selections, key in a number or enter text as appropriate.
5.
Press [*] to accept and move to the next option.
6.
Once all options are configured, the system prompts to enroll the next device.
7.
Repeat the process described above until all wireless devices are enrolled.
NOTE: The configuration options listed above can be modified using [804][911] Modify Device.
